<h2>Answer:</h2>

The Slope is \frac{1}{4}\\

<h2>Explanation:</h2>

Notice that both the points, (-7,-6) and (-3,-5), are on the line. So we can use those points to calculate the slope. Recall that that slope of the line m can be calculated by \frac{y_2 -y_1}{x_2 -x_1}\\ if we have the points, (x_1,y_1) and (x_2,y_2).

<h3>Calculating for the slope of the line:</h3>

Given

(-7,-6)

(-3,-5)

m = \frac{-5 -(-6)}{-3 -(-7)} \\ m = \frac{-5 +6}{-3 +7} \\ m = \frac{1}{4}
